WASHINGTON, DC -- The U.S. Consumer Product Safety Commission announced that Gund Inc. of Edison, NJ, has issued a voluntary recall of 18,900 Woodle Activity Toys because the wooden rings on the stuffed toy can break and pose a choking hazard to young children.
Gund has received four reports from consumers about the wooden rings on the toys breaking, including one report of a child mouthing small pieces. No injuries were reported.
The product, made in Vietnam, retails for about $12. Consumers are urged to contact Gund to receive a free replacement product.
